When Team Cherry confirmed it was working on new content for Hollow Knight: Silksong, there was concern that there would be another long wait. Fortunately, that doesnโt seem to be the case, as it announced Sea of Sorrow, a free expansion coming next year. Check out the first teaser trailer below.
Details are scant at the moment, but itโs nautically themed and will feature new areas, tools to discover and bosses to fight. Team Cherry is currently keeping things under wraps, but it has interestingly noted that you can expect โadditional infoโ before launch. Which means the next time we hear about Sea of Sorrow could be right before itโs available, in classic Team Cherry fashion.
